Here’s the same component written using a conditional ternary operator. WebMar 20, 2024 · The working of the switch statement in C is as follows: Step 1: The switch expression is evaluated. Step 2: The evaluated value is then matched against the present case values. Step 3A: If the matching case value is found, that case block is executed. Step 3B: If the matching code is not found, then the default case block is executed if present.
